This will be the major fundraiser for Park Lawn, a non-profit organization serving adults with developmental and intellectual challenges by providing choice, independence, and access to community living. It does this through adult day programs, life-skills training, adult employment services, and community activities, and has served more than 20,000 clients since its opening in 1995.
Profits from this fundraiser will go to facility improvements, continuing programs, direct services, community-living initiatives and employment training and placement.
